5,683 Results for
1
Filter
5,685 Results for
125
Nars
N/A
FREE GIFT
Out of Stock
Charlotte Tilbury
Price reduced from
£69.00
to
£55.20
Out of Stock
You've viewed 4,500 of 5,685 products